Transaction de419f31d28a7a2d543c29ac665a7348602a78ebdff8d42d9cd4516ac1ea6012
1 Input
1 Output
-
de419f31d28a7a2d543c29ac665a7348602a78ebdff8d42d9cd4516ac1ea6012:0
- value
- 3980635
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dda49f52e2d41f887f590146a995c61a60c44384 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MCwYZH7nCQkwx2q6rxzbbcnbxyzuBF99U